The progressive sextet founded in 2001 in Tilburg, the Netherlands, has had an interesting career. Starting with their 2004 debut Polars, they combined the mathematical style of Meshuggah with the melodicism and drive of Göteborg-bands like Soilwork in their own way to become one of the key progressive bands in Europe with their distinctive progressive mindset, featuring both djent and metalcore, with the subsequent album Drawing Circles.

TEXTURES, who from the start had a player backing their music with atmospheric synth landscapes, have always been one of the most inventive and instrumentally gifted, but from a band with death metal beginnings few would have expected such a development.

However, after a string of successful albums, with TEXTURES already appearing on the national charts since their third album Silhouettes, several line-up changes have been made and the Dutch groove innovators are calling it quits a year after the release of their fifth album Phenotype (2016), despite initially announcing it as an ambitious two-piece concept.
